What are the characteristics of energy storage technologies for Automotive Systems?

Characteristics of Energy Storage Technologies for Automotive Systems In the automotive industry, many devices are used to store energy in different forms. The most commonly used ones are batteries and supercapacitors, which store energy in electrical form, as well as flywheels, which store energy in mechanical form.

Which energy storage sources are used in electric vehicles?

Electric vehicles (EVs) require high-performance ESSs that are reliable with high specific energy to provide long driving range . The main energy storage sources that are implemented in EVs include electrochemical, chemical, electrical, mechanical, and hybrid ESSs, either singly or in conjunction with one another.
